IV HEALTH HAZARD INFORMATION
rioutes of Exposure When Processing or Handling
inhalation Dust, vapor and/or fume may be. irritating to the respiratory system, and
can resutt in both acute and chronic overexposure.
Skin Contact Dust, vapor and/or fuive may cause irritation.
Skin AWorptjon Dust, vapor and/or fume are not readily absorbed through the shin.
Eye Contact Dust,vapor and/or fume may cause irritation.
Ingestion — Dust, va�or aid/or fume may be absorbed by the digestive system,and
can resuit in both acute and chronic overexposure.
Effects of Overexposure
Acute Overexposure If left untreated: weakness, vomiting, loss of appetite, uncoordinated body
movements, convulsions, stupor, bloody stools,and possMy coma.
Chronic overexposure If left untreated: weakness, insomnia, hypertension, slight irritation to
skin and eyes, metallic taste in mouth, anemia, constipatioil, headache,
muscle and joint ppains, neuromuscular d}sfunction, possible paralysis
and encephalopatlty, pneumucuiliosls and n;etal fume fc,,er.

Notes to Physician
Lead and its inorganic compounds are neurotoxins which may produce peripheral neuropathy. For
i an overview of the effects of lead exposure, consult Occupational Safety and Health Administration
i Appendix A of Occupational Exposure to Lead (29CFK1910.1025). Arsenic may be a pulmonary
carcinogen. For an overview of the effects of arsenic exposure, consult Occupational Safety and
Health Administration Appendices of Occupational Exposure to Inorganic Arsenic (29CFR1410.1018),
Arsenic, antimony, tin and inorganic On compounds are primary chemical irritants of the skin.
The chronic effects of antimony ingestion may resemble those of arsenic. Antimony is a severe
pulmonary irritant, and stannic oxide has been shown to Cause benign pneumoconiosis, Copper
is not normally toxic when ingested orally in amounts expected from occupational exposure. Exposure
to copper dust, vapor or fumes may cause metal fume fever. Aluminum powder causes pneumoconiosis in
humans when inhaled as a very fine powder in ma»ive concentrations.

VII SPILL OR LEAK PROCEDURES
Steps To Be Taken it Material is Released or Spilled
Dust material should be vacuumed, or wet swept where vacuuming is not feasible. Particulate matter
should be stared in dry containers for lacer disposal. Do not use �:ullly,,:ssid ail or dry sweeping as u
means of cleaning.

IX SPECIAL PRECAUTIONS
PRECAUTIONARY
STATFMENTS
There are two major means of heavy metal absorption; namely, inhalation and ingestion. Most inhalation
problems can be preYentcd with adequate use of aforementioned ventilation and respirator information.
Always exercise normal, good personal hygiene prior to smoking or eating. Smoking and eating should
6e confined to non-contaminated areas.
Work clothes and cquipmenr should remain in designated lead contaminated areas, and never taken
home car laundered with personal clothing. Launder contaminated clothing before reuse.
Wash hands, face, n;ck and arms thoroughly before eating ur smoking.
The product is intended for industrial use only, and should be isolated from children and their
environment.
